LA California Automobile Insurance: 3 More Tested Tips
You don't need to do difficult things in most cases in order to lower your Los Angeles CA car insurance rates. It's usually small things that result in huge savings. I'll take the pains in this article to share such things...
1. It is less expensive to insure your vehicle if you stay in a rural area. If you can reside in a sparsely populated area you'll be eligible for the cheaper quotes since the risk of vandalism, crash or theft is so low in such localities.
2. Re-assessing your auto insurance policy at regular intervals is one sure way you can bring down your rates. Change is unavoidable and happens without our permission but then we mustn't still bear the cost for issues that such changes have relieved us of. A perfect example is a situation where someone leaves their wedded daughter on their policy for months or even a few years simply because it did NOT occur to them.
The changes in your life might have qualified you for some discounts. You might as well have "outgrown" the need for several coverage types.
Therefore, do NOT fail to review your policy every so often. Don't be surprised if you find out that you need to make adjustments or if you see changes that will give you considerable savings.
